Agreed ^^

If you look around this site enough you will find your answer. However, I will tell you that I ordered multiple books of 1st class stamps from the RoyalMail website and once you get your account set up, it's so easy to order from them! I live in the US and when I send to the UK, I usually put 3 first class stamps on the return envelope. Right, wrong or indifferent that's what I do and I've had success with my mail being returned to me. Good luck.
